After winning the Mainstay Cup, two Kaizer Chiefs hardmen, Jan 'Malombo' Lechaba and Jackie Masike, got stuck into one another during their celebrations.
Chiefs legends, Ace Ntsoelengoe and Banks Setlhodi, told the story to Soccer Laduma along with Malombo, recapping an eventful night at Msidi's Place in Soweto.
"It was after a Mainstay Final that we'd won and we were all celebrating at a shebeen called Msidi's Place, it was in Meadowlands in Soweto," said Ace.
"In those days before I arrived at the club, Jackie Masike was the 'top dog' at Chiefs. He was a tough guy who was the main man when it came to being able to handle himself when it came to fighting. Jackie was a big guy and he knew his stuff."
Malombo added, "So one day Ace says to me, 'Malombo, Jackie is always bullying everyone. On and off the field, he is dictating everything.' So, I began to think that maybe I should 'fix' him."
Following the game, Banks revealed that they knew trouble was brewing, saying, "I was pushing Jackie and Ace was pushing Malombo. It started when I said to Jackie, 'Hey, Jackie, Jan is trying to take over as the boss. He has the backing of Ace.'
"I said, 'Jackie, now it's your time, go and do your thing.' The next thing Jackie went up to Malombo and hit him one big punch between the chin and the ears.
"I could see Malombo and, as you know, Malombo is pitch black, and he just started turning grey. But Malombo never even fell, he just stood there. He just said, 'Jackie, what are you doing?'
"Then Jackie landed another big punch and Malombo just said again, 'Jackie, why do you want to fight me?'
"The next thing, Malombo just let fly with one punch and Jackie was flat out on the floor. Jackie tried to get up quickly as if nothing had happened, but he couldn't. Just imagine the scene - Big Jackie on the floor. I mean, Jackie was the big guy of the team, the whole of Soweto knew him as a tough guy and Malombo was new."
